根据网上说的都是:

我试了很久,也用了很多最终的结果,没有任何变化:
后来才发现是新创建的用户的问题,需要这样操作
注意我新创建的数据库的用户是master,所以对新创建的需要这样操作一次
虽然我创建的命令是:
CREATE USER 'master'@'%' IDENTIFIED BY 'CrP#EerDqa' 但是很奇怪,我就是需要重新更新一下,才可以太奇怪了;
update user set host='%' where user='master';
Grant all privileges on *.* to 'master'@'%';
本文记录了一次解决MySQL新创建用户无法正常使用的问题过程。作者最初尝试通过CREATE USER命令创建了一个名为master的用户,但发现该用户无法正常工作。经过多次尝试后,作者发现需要通过更新用户设置和授予所有权限来解决问题。


被折叠的 条评论
为什么被折叠?



